: Photography ranges from sweeping aerial views of herons in flight to microscopic close-ups of seeds and leaf veins.
Reviewers have described the book as a "prose poem" and a "visual journey that immerses you deep into the woods". Sierra Magazine called it "an invitation to join in the eloquence of seeing," while the Royal Society of Biology praised its "perfect symbiosis between text and photographs".
